Recognizing Wills and Trusts: Which Is Right for You?
When considering exactly how to handle your estate, you might question: what's the difference between a will and a depend on? A will is a lawful file that outlines exactly how you want your assets dispersed after your fatality. It goes through probate, which can be time-consuming and public.
On the other hand, a trust fund enables you to move assets throughout your lifetime, preventing probate. This means your recipients can access their inheritance more quickly and privately. Trusts also use extra control over exactly how and when your possessions are dispersed.
Depending upon your requirements-- like asset security or lessening taxes-- you may find one option preferable than the various other. Examine your goals to identify which estate Planning tool fits your situation best.

Picking Guardianship: Ensuring Your Kid's Future?
Just how can you guarantee your youngsters's future if something unanticipated occurs to you? Picking a guardian is among the most critical decisions you'll make in your estate Planning.
You need somebody that shares your worths and can supply a steady, loving setting for your kids. Consider their parenting design, monetary security, and desire to handle the duty.
It's essential to review your wishes with prospective guardians to ensure they fit with the dedication. You ought to likewise name a back-up guardian in case your first choice can not offer.
